Thermostatic Valve 47521495005 for Air Compressors

The Thermostatic Valve 47521495005 plays an important role in maintaining proper temperature conditions inside compatible industrial air compressor systems. Air compressors generate heat during compression, and the lubrication oil absorbs a significant amount of this heat. The compressor must maintain the oil within an appropriate operating temperature range to support effective lubrication, cooling, and overall reliability.

The thermostatic valve helps regulate oil flow according to temperature conditions. By directing oil through the appropriate cooling path when required, the valve helps the compressor maintain stable operating temperatures.

A properly functioning thermostatic valve can support compressor efficiency, component protection, and dependable operation in demanding industrial environments.

Regulate Compressor Oil Temperature

The primary function of a thermostatic valve is to help manage oil temperature. Compressor oil performs several important functions, including lubrication, sealing, cooling, and protecting internal components.

When oil temperature changes significantly, its operating characteristics can also change. Excessively high temperatures can reduce oil performance and increase thermal stress, while operating at an unsuitable temperature can affect lubrication and moisture management.

The 47521495005 Thermostatic Valve helps control oil circulation so the compressor can maintain a suitable operating temperature under changing conditions.

Control Oil Flow During Operation

A thermostatic valve responds to temperature conditions and regulates the oil-flow route accordingly. During compressor operation, the valve can help determine whether oil should pass through the cooling circuit or follow an alternative circulation path.

This temperature-based flow control helps the compressor reach and maintain its intended operating condition.

When the oil requires additional cooling, the valve can direct flow toward the cooler. When additional cooling is not required, the valve can help regulate the flow according to the system’s designed temperature-control strategy.

This process supports stable compressor operation across different load and ambient conditions.

Recognize Signs of Thermostatic Valve Problems

A thermostatic valve can experience wear, contamination, sticking, or other problems over time. Operators should pay attention to changes in compressor temperature and operating behavior.

Potential signs of a temperature-control problem may include:

  • Abnormally high oil temperature
  • Unstable operating temperature
  • Increased compressor shutdowns
  • Oil overheating
  • Reduced cooling performance
  • Unusual temperature fluctuations
  • Lubrication-related concerns
  • Temperature alarms

These symptoms can also result from other problems, such as a blocked cooler, incorrect oil level, contaminated oil, restricted airflow, faulty sensors, or cooling-fan problems.

Therefore, technicians should inspect the complete system before replacing the valve.

Install the Thermostatic Valve Correctly

Proper installation helps the valve perform reliably. Qualified technicians should replace the thermostatic valve according to the applicable compressor service procedure.

Before starting work, isolate the compressor and allow the system to cool. Depressurize the applicable system safely and follow appropriate industrial safety procedures.

During installation, the technician should inspect the valve housing, seals, connections, oil passages, and surrounding components.

The technician should also replace damaged sealing components where required and ensure that all connections remain clean and properly secured.

After installation, check the compressor for oil leaks and monitor operating temperature during commissioning.
